Obituary of Louise Cabe

Louise Cabe, age 80, of Cherokee passed away on August 15, 2021 after and extended illness. She is the daughter of the late Robert and Charlotte Cabe. She is survived by her Daughters; Misty Cabe and Melanie Parton. 8 Grandchildren and 1 Great Grandchild. Also surviving is Special Sister; Susie Plummer. There are too many Special Friends to name that are considered as Family, you know who you are. The family does not want to take any chances by leaving someone out. In addition to her parents, Louise was preceded in death by her Sons; Leland (Charlie Brown) Parton and Lew Parton. Brothers; Robert (Dugan) Cabe, Howard (Babe) Cabe and Kenneth Smith. Sister; Sandra Cabe Davis. Grandchild; Emma Grace Lequire. Louise worked for years at Cherokee High School as Assistant PE Teacher. many of the young people became her boys and girls for life.
